Understanding Lithromanticism

Lithromanticism is a sexual orientation characterized by experiencing romantic attraction to others without any desire for a reciprocated relationship. Unlike other forms of romantic attraction, lithromantics find joy and fulfillment in the feeling of romantic love itself, regardless of whether it’s returned. This can manifest as an appreciation for someone’s qualities, admiring their personality, or feeling emotionally connected without yearning for a physical or emotional commitment.

Lithromanticism is often misunderstood as simply being “uninterested in relationships” or “not wanting to date.” However, lithromantics do experience romantic feelings; they simply don’t desire them to be reciprocated. They may cherish the feeling of love and admiration without feeling the need to pursue a traditional romantic relationship.

A key distinction between lithromanticism and other orientations lies in the absence of the desire for a reciprocated relationship. While aromantic individuals don’t experience romantic attraction at all, lithromantics do feel romantic attraction but choose not to pursue it romantically. Similarly, while demisexuals experience sexual attraction only after forming a strong emotional bond, lithromantics may or may not experience sexual attraction, and this is unrelated to their desire for a reciprocated romantic relationship.

Lithromanticism emphasizes the individual’s internal experience of romantic attraction and their choice to not pursue reciprocation. It’s about finding fulfillment in the feeling of love itself, regardless of whether it’s returned.

Social interactions for lithromantics can be complex and vary depending on individual comfort levels and experiences. Some lithromantics may choose to disclose their orientation to others, finding it helpful for building understanding and authenticity in relationships. Others may prefer to keep it private.

When interacting with people romantically, lithromantics might express admiration or affection without expecting a romantic response. They may find joy in sharing intimate thoughts and feelings without the pressure of reciprocation. It’s important for others to respect their boundaries and understand that a lack of desire for a relationship doesn’t mean they are uninterested in connection.

Challenges and Stigma

Lithromanticism, though still relatively underrepresented, is gaining more visibility within discussions about diverse sexual orientations. It challenges the traditional view that romantic attraction always necessitates a desire for reciprocation.

However, despite increased understanding, lithromantics often face unique challenges and stigma.

One significant challenge is being misunderstood as simply “not interested in relationships” or being aromantic. This misconception leads to assumptions about their capacity for love and connection, creating a barrier to authentic communication.

Another hurdle lies in navigating social expectations that prioritize romantic partnerships. Lithromantics may experience pressure from friends and family to seek out traditional relationships, which can be emotionally draining and isolating.
